Statute of Limitations

M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ases can take years to develop, which could delay the time limit for filing a lawsuit. A knowledgeable attorney can help victims determine their deadlines and file within them. The lawyer will examine the claim and notify the defendants. The lawyer will then build the case with evidence, or reach a settlement with defendants or argue in court for a jury verdict.

The statute of limitations for states that are specific to personal injury and wrongful death cases vary. Numerous factors influence how the statute of limitations will be used, including when asbestos exposure occurred, where the victim lives, what states they worked in, and the location of asbestos companies.

The rule of discovery is beneficial for the majority of asbestos victims. It allows the limitation period to begin at the time that the disease was discovered, or at the time it would be reasonable to be discovered. This differs from the statutory periods of states which are typically established to begin with the date of first exposure.

The statute of limitations could be extended, or even paused, in certain circumstances like when the victim is a minor, or lacked the legal capacity to file. In some cases like fraud concealment the statute of limitations may be extended.

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os victims who suffer from mesothelioma and other asbestos diseases may seek compensation through trust funds. These funds were established by companies that manufactured or supplied asbestos-containing product and ended up in bankruptcy. These compan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to put funds in trusts to pay compensation to victims of asbestos-containing products.

To be eligible for financial compensation, victims must meet the eligibility criteria of each asbestos trust. A qualified mesothelioma lawyer will help a victim understand how these criteria work and collect the necessary documents needed to submit claims. This includes documents proving employment, military service documents and medical records that demonstrate the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ness.

Mesothelioma attorneys also help victims file for speedier reviews with each asbestos trust fund. This allows claims to be processed faster and can increase the amount of compensation an individual receives. However, there is a limit on the amount a person is able to get through expedited review.

The asbestos trust fund is able to provide compensation up to six figures for those with asbestos-related conditions. This compensation is designed to cover a range of expenses including mesothelioma treatment funeral costs, lost income and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ation can be in the form of a cash settlement or a jury verdict. The value of a claim depends on the type and severity of the asbestos-related illness, the degree to which the victim's quality life has diminished, the amount of lost wages and medical expenses. A mesothelioma lawyer will review your case and provide you the options available for compensation.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led without the courtroom. Defendant companies do not wish to incur the cost of trial, so they settle their cases relatively early in the legal process.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ma cases are able to determine potential sources of compensation swiftly. They will often review decades-old records of purchase orders or witness statements and then review other records to determine asbestos exposure at a specific location.

The companies that mined and produced asbestos, as well as those that produced and used asbestos-containing items, should pay out awards to victims of mesothelioma. The victims are typically exposed workers who were deprived of their rights by defendants who placed them in the presence of this carcinogen.

In most states, anyone diagnosed with mesothelioma has the right to sue the companies who caused the injury. These lawsuits are referred to as personal injury or mesothelioma lawsuits.

Workers' compensation claims may be filed by people or their loved ones who have been diagnosed with asbestos-related illnesses. These claims could cover medical costs and income loss. These claims are typically filed with the state's workers' compensation office. It is also important to consider whether they qualify for government-run insurance programs such as Medicare and Medicaid, which provide health insurance for seniors and individuals with low household incomes.

Veterans who were exposed asbestos while serving in military can apply for VA benefits. VA benefits cover the cost of treatment at a few of the world's leading mesothelioma clinics and also provide a monthly disability payment that is based upon the severity of a service-connected illness or injury, such as mesothelioma. These benefits do not interfere with the filing of a personal injury lawsuit or VA disability compensation claim. However, veterans must file both in order to receive the maximum amount of compensation.
